• Kim Soo Hyun’s Agency Breaks Silence on Kim Sae Ron’s 700 Million KRW Debt Denying Actor’s Involvement: ‘He Never Ignored Her’"

    Kim Soo Hyun’s agency has officially denied rumors that the actor ignored the late Kim Sae Ron’s financial struggles, clarifying that the debt issue was strictly between Kim Sae Ron and Gold Medalist.

    On March 14, Gold Medalist released a strong statement responding to speculation that Kim Soo Hyun turned his back on Kim Sae Ron while she was struggling with debt.

    "Reports suggesting that Kim Soo Hyun ignored Kim Sae Ron’s financial issues are completely false," the agency stated.

    They directly refuted claims made by the controversial Garo Sero Institute, which suggested that Kim Soo Hyun’s silence led to Kim Sae Ron’s tragic passing.

    "The rumors claim that Kim Soo Hyun ignored Kim Sae Ron’s plea for help while our agency pressured her to repay debts from her DUI accident. However, this is absolutely untrue."

    According to Gold Medalist, Kim Sae Ron’s total penalty fees from her DUI incident amounted to 1.14 billion KRW.

    The agency stepped in to negotiate and reduce the amount, lowering it to around 700 million KRW.

    The agency also took care of her damaged car, handling its repair and sale, using the proceeds to cover part of the damages.

    Despite their efforts, Kim Sae Ron continued to struggle financially, and in December 2023, Gold Medalist wrote off the remaining debt as a loss, officially closing the matter.

    "After we wrote off her debt, we never demanded repayment from Kim Sae Ron again. It is completely unreasonable to link her passing to this issue."

    Gold Medalist made it clear that Kim Soo Hyun was never personally involved in the debt issue.

    "Kim Soo Hyun never loaned Kim Sae Ron money or pressured her to repay anything. The financial issue was strictly between Kim Sae Ron and Gold Medalist."

    The agency also addressed rumors that Kim Sae Ron had reached out to Kim Soo Hyun for help, explaining that she initially contacted him for legal advice since she had no legal representation at the time.

    Later, she hired her own attorney to negotiate the debt situation.

    Kim Sae Ron was previously fined 20 million KRW for a DUI accident in May 2022, after crashing into a tree and a transformer before fleeing the scene.

    Gold Medalist initially covered the damages but later sent her a legal notice regarding the remaining 700 million KRW debt.

    Amid her financial struggles, reports claim Kim Sae Ron sought help from her former romantic partner, Kim Soo Hyun, but was left without support.

    Following her tragic passing on February 16, 2024, speculation arose that Gold Medalist’s debt collection efforts played a role in her difficulties, leading to public scrutiny of both the agency and Kim Soo Hyun.

  • Kim Soo Hyun Cannot Be Prosecuted for Alleged Relationship with the Late Kim Sae Ron as a Minor—Lawyer Explains Why the Law Does Not Apply

    Kim Soo Hyun has admitted to dating the late Kim Sae Ron but strongly denies that their relationship began when she was a minor.

    On March 14, Kim Soo Hyun’s agency, Gold Medalist, released a statement saying, “Kim Soo Hyun and Kim Sae Ron dated from the summer of 2019, after she became an adult, until the fall of 2020.” They emphasized, “The claim that he was in a relationship with her when she was a minor is not true.”

    The agency also clarified that the photos of the two, which were revealed by Garo Sero Research Institute (Gaseyeon) and Kim Sae Ron herself, were taken in 2020 when she was already of legal age.

    Regarding the legal implications of the allegations, lawyer Lee Go Eun appeared on YTN News to discuss whether Kim Soo Hyun could face charges if it were proven that he had been in a relationship with Kim Sae Ron when she was underage.

    When asked about the possibility of legal punishment, Lee explained, “Under the law revised in May 2020, any physical relationship with a minor under the age of 16, even with consent, could lead to serious charges.”

    However, she pointed out a key legal detail, saying, “Before the 2020 revision, the law applied only to minors under 13 years old. Since Kim Sae Ron was 15 in 2015, the legal framework at the time does not classify her as a protected minor in this context.”

    Lee concluded, “Given the laws in place at the time, it seems difficult for Kim Soo Hyun to face legal consequences.”

    She further added, “For any case to proceed against him, there would need to be clear evidence of more than just dating. Based on what is currently known, holding him legally accountable may be challenging.”
